WebFeb 22, 2024 · Merit-Ptah is not only the first female doctor known by name but the first woman mentioned in the study of science. The first female physician in Egyptian history, as noted above, is Merit-Ptah ('Beloved of Ptah') who lived c. 2700 BCE toward the end of the Early Dynastic Period. WebAncient Egyptian doctors were specialized in dentistry, pharmacology, gynecology, autopsy, embalming and general healing. The largest contribution the ancient Egyptians made was their documentation and … Physicians in ancient Egypt could be male or female. The "first physician", later deified as a god of medicine and healing, was the architect Imhotep (c. 2667-2600 BCE) best known for designing the Step Pyramid of Djoser at Saqqara. They had advanced knowledge of anatomy and surgery. Also, they treated a lot of diseases including dental, gynecological, gastrointestinal, and urinary disorders.
